The Rocketfish 6 Outlet/2 USB Swivel Wall Tap is a high-performance surge protector featuring a robust 2100-joule rating, designed to safeguard your home appliances. With six outlets and two USB ports, it offers versatile charging options while its EMI/RFI noise filter ensures optimal device performance. The low-profile design makes it perfect for any space, enhancing your home entertainment system effortlessly.

Beware...despite good ratings
In Dec 2021, a transformer in my neighborhood failed and created a blackout for about 10k residents for a few hours. I had my Samsung smart tv plugged into this Rocketfish surge protector. Unfortunately, when the power was restored my television would not turn back on despite the surge protector apparently working as indicated by the green "protected" and "grounded" lights on.The link on the detail page for warranty info is blank. I emailed Rocketfish for warranty/replacement info and never heard from them. Finally reached their customer service department by phone. I explained that I purchased my surge protector two years ago, referenced the warranty info on Rocketfish's own detail page (Rocketfish™ $150,000 lifetime equipment guarantee), and asked for the process to repair/replace my TV.The agent put me on hold and came back and asked if I had purchased an extended warranty on my surge protector. I hadn't. That is when Rocketfish informed me that my surge protector was out of warranty after 12 months and faulty, resulting in not protecting my TV. I challenged him that how would he know it's faulty and shared that it was plugged in and I could see the green lights indicating "protected" and "grounded". I asked that he escalate to a manager and was promised a call or email back. Never came.Beware, apparently the warranties on surge protectors from Rocketfish is a marketing gimmick that sells devices but there is no actual guarantee outside of the 12 month surge protector warranty. I'll never buy a rocketfish product again and it seems ridiculous that I'd have to get an extended warranty on a $30 surge protector or have to buy a new one every year to stay in warranty.
